Tri-at-the-Y : |
Triathlon : Bike 8 Miles, Run 2 Miles, Swim 300 Yards |
What:
Winter format, Super Sprint Triathlon (Bike 8 mi., Run 2 mi., Swim 300 Yards)
Where:
Floyd County YMCA, 33 State Street, New Albany, IN
When:
Saturday, March 27, 2010 1
st Bike Wave @ 10:00 a.m.Contact:
Julie CallawayMandatory:
Pre-Race Meeting at 9:30 a.m. in Bike Transition AreaTransition Area located at the Basketball Court on the south side of the floodwall. Bikes must be racked in the transition area by 9:30 am. All participants are required to wear an ANSI approved helmet to race. Bring your helmet to the Body Marking Station (Multi-purpose room).
Cycling -Begin at New Albany Riverfront starting line heading west on Water Street proceed WSW on West Water Street/Floyd Street turn right on Jackson Street and left on Galiger Station Road. Turn around at the designated point near the end of Galiger Station Road and return to the starting point on East Water Street on the same path. Stay to the right. Repeat three times. Distance is approximately 8 miles. Route is basicly flat.
Transition Cycling to Running
Running-Begin at New Albany Riverfront starting line on Water Street heading East on East Water Street. Turn around at the designated point just after the RR bridge and return on the same path, staying to the right. Proceed beyond the starting line to the levee stairs. WALK down the stairs to the designated YMCA entrance. Distance is approximately 2 miles. Route is basicly flat.
Transition Running to Swimming. 300 yard Indoor pool swim.
Directions from I-64W:
At the corner of State and Main in New Albany. Take exit 123 toward New Albany and continue straight on Elm Street. Turn right on State Street.
